Note: Making the following modification could make your computer or network more vulnerable to attack by malicious users or by malicious software such as viruses. In order to open a TestStand XML report in Microsoft Excel, you must make some modifications to the registry to disable this security check.

If the security is not configured properly, the following XML error will be displayed:ĭescription: Security settings do not allow the execution of script code within this stylesheet. The XML report may fail to open if the XSL security settings for Microsoft Excel are not configured to allow scripts in stylesheets. Change this path value to match the file location of the XSL stylesheet on the machine. The value that you will need to modify in the XML document is the href attribute of the xml-stylesheet element, which should be located at the beginning of the document. If the specific stylesheet is not present at that location on the machine that is being used, then you may either open the document in Microsoft Excel without styling or manually modify the path for the stylesheet by opening the XML document in a text editor. Select Open the file with the following stylesheet applied. Microsoft Excel pulls the path of the stylesheet to be used from the XML document itself, so you do not have to set the file path.
